Motorola has announced a new Moto Mod for its Moto Z Android smartphones that allows users to instantly print their captured photos. Called the Polaroid Insta-Share Printer, the new Moto Mod will be available on Nov. 17 for $199.99.

“Turn your smartphone into an instant photo printer to share your moment, in the moment, with the new Polaroid Insta-Share Printer Moto Mod,” Motorola said on its blog. “Your Moto Z already captures all your favorite moments, and now you can treasure them with the latest innovation in instant printing. The Polaroid Insta-Share Printer brings your photos to life in seconds, letting you enjoy photos beyond your smartphone screen.”

To use the Insta-Share Printer, users will only have to snap it on the back of their compatible Moto Z smartphones. Moto Mods currently only work for the Moto Z2 Force Edition, Z2 Play and the Z Force Droid. Once the Insta-Share Printer is attached to the user’s smartphone, the user will have to push the physical button to launch the camera app.

After taking photos, users will be able to start printing them through the Insta-Share Printer. The new Moto Mod prints the images in a small 2 x 3-inch paper created by Polaroid that’s called ZINK (Zero-INK) Paper. Using this type of paper means that the printer doesn’t use ink so there’s no chance of any smudging in printed images and users won’t have to refill any sort of ink cartridges in the Insta-Share Printer, according to Digital Trends.

Additionally, the Insta-Share Printer lets users print photos that they have in their phone’s camera roll. Users also have the option to print photos that they’ve saved from Instagram, Facebook, Google Photos or other social media accounts. Users can also edit their photos to add different borders with other apps and start printing.

The Polaroid Insta-Share Printer Moto Mod is a convenient way for Moto Z users to have their very own portable photo printer. However, it’s $199.99 price tag is a bit steep and is even pricier than some traditional standalone cameras. The new Moto Mod is even more expensive than Polaroid’s own $99.99 OneStep 2 instant camera, as pointed out by Mashable.

Expensive pricing for Moto Mods has become a pattern with Motorola. The last major Moto Mod that the company released was the Moto Smart Speaker with Amazon Alexa. That, too, is considered to be a bit pricey since it’s being sold for $149.99 in the United States. Some of Amazon’s own Echo and Echo Dot smart speakers are way cheaper at $99 and $49, respectively.

Pricing aside, the introduction of the new Insta-Share Printer and other snap-on accessories for Moto Z smartphones shows that Motorola is committed to releasing new Moto Mods. Users who have bought any of the latest Moto Z smartphones will feel a bit more confident in their investment and won’t regret getting a modular Android smartphone.

The Polaroid Insta-Share Printer Moto Mod will first be available this Friday on Nov. 17 from Verizon stores. The new Moto Mod will also be available from Best Buy, B&H, Fry’s and NewEgg starting on Dec. 13, according to Engadget.
